Loweynet
修订版 | fb60b11223517040606aa6b531a1e59102d7704b (tree) |
---|---|
时间 | 2017-10-29 17:30:42 |
作者 | s_kawamoto <s_kawamoto@user...> |
Commiter | s_kawamoto |
Fix bugs of host switching.
@@ -11,8 +11,8 @@ set PREFIX_JPN=update.jpn.file. | ||
11 | 11 | set PREFIX_ENG=update.eng.file. |
12 | 12 | set PREFIX_AMD64_JPN=update.amd64.jpn.file. |
13 | 13 | set PREFIX_AMD64_ENG=update.amd64.eng.file. |
14 | -set DESC_JPN="]¸sÉÄÚ±Å«È¢êª éoOðC³µÜµ½B\nØfÉt@CÌ]Ò¿ªð³êÈ¢oOðC³µÜµ½B\n]̧I¹ª@\µÈ¢êª éoOðC³µÜµ½B\n]̧I¹ª@\µÈ¢êª éoOðC³µÜµ½B\nóM~ðNbNµ½ãÌ®ª¨©µÈéoOðC³µÜµ½B" | |
15 | -set DESC_ENG="Fixed bugs that sometimes it cannot reconnect after transfer failure.\nFixed bugs that the queue of file transfer is not released on disconnection.\nFixed bugs that sometimes Force Exit does not work while transfer.\nFixed bugs that the behavior is strange after clicking Stop button." | |
14 | +set DESC_JPN="¯Ú±ª1æèå«¢zXg©çØfµ½¼ãÉÊÌzXgÅ]ɸs·éoOðC³µÜµ½B" | |
15 | +set DESC_ENG="Fixed bugs that transfer fails at a host right after disconnection from another host whose number of simultaneous connections is more than 1." | |
16 | 16 | set DESC_AMD64_JPN=%DESC_JPN% |
17 | 17 | set DESC_AMD64_ENG=%DESC_ENG% |
18 | 18 |
@@ -242,7 +242,7 @@ FONT 9, "MS Shell Dlg", 0, 0, 0x0 | ||
242 | 242 | BEGIN |
243 | 243 | DEFPUSHBUTTON "OK",IDOK,133,294,50,14 |
244 | 244 | ICON ffftp,-1,7,4,20,20 |
245 | - CTEXT "FFFTP Ver 1.99a-20171028",-1,113,11,90,8 | |
245 | + CTEXT "FFFTP Ver 1.99a-20171029",-1,113,11,90,8 | |
246 | 246 | CTEXT "FFFTPÍfreewareÅ·",-1,7,279,305,8 |
247 | 247 | CTEXT "Copyright(C) 1997-2010 Sota & ²¦Í¢½¾¢½ûX\nCopyright (C) 2011-2017 FFFTP Project (Hiromichi Matsushima, Suguru Kawamoto, IWAMOTO Kouichi, vitamin0x, ¤È[, Asami, fortran90, tomo1192, Yuji Tanaka, Moriguchi Hirokazu, Ó¤¹ñ)",-1,7,25,305,44,SS_NOPREFIX |
248 | 248 | CTEXT "",ABOUT_JRE,7,96,305,8 |
@@ -2213,8 +2213,8 @@ nodrop_csr CURSOR "nodrop_c.cur" | ||
2213 | 2213 | // |
2214 | 2214 | |
2215 | 2215 | VS_VERSION_INFO VERSIONINFO |
2216 | - FILEVERSION 1,99,1,17 | |
2217 | - PRODUCTVERSION 1,99,1,17 | |
2216 | + FILEVERSION 1,99,1,18 | |
2217 | + PRODUCTVERSION 1,99,1,18 | |
2218 | 2218 | FILEFLAGSMASK 0x3fL |
2219 | 2219 | #ifdef _DEBUG |
2220 | 2220 | FILEFLAGS 0x1L |
@@ -2232,12 +2232,12 @@ BEGIN | ||
2232 | 2232 | VALUE "Comments", "±êÍt[\tgEGAÅ·B" |
2233 | 2233 | VALUE "CompanyName", "Sota, FFFTP Project" |
2234 | 2234 | VALUE "FileDescription", "FFFTP" |
2235 | - VALUE "FileVersion", "1, 99, 1, 17" | |
2235 | + VALUE "FileVersion", "1, 99, 1, 18" | |
2236 | 2236 | VALUE "InternalName", "FFFTP" |
2237 | 2237 | VALUE "LegalCopyright", "Copyright (C) 1997-2010 Sota & ²¦Í¢½¾¢½ûX\nCopyright (C) 2011-2017 FFFTP Project (Hiromichi Matsushima, Suguru Kawamoto, IWAMOTO Kouichi, vitamin0x, ¤È[, Asami, fortran90, tomo1192, Yuji Tanaka, Moriguchi Hirokazu, Ó¤¹ñ)." |
2238 | 2238 | VALUE "OriginalFilename", "FFFTP.exe" |
2239 | 2239 | VALUE "ProductName", "FFFTP" |
2240 | - VALUE "ProductVersion", "1, 99, 1, 17" | |
2240 | + VALUE "ProductVersion", "1, 99, 1, 18" | |
2241 | 2241 | END |
2242 | 2242 | END |
2243 | 2243 | BLOCK "VarFileInfo" |
@@ -242,7 +242,7 @@ FONT 9, "MS Shell Dlg", 0, 0, 0x0 | ||
242 | 242 | BEGIN |
243 | 243 | DEFPUSHBUTTON "OK",IDOK,132,296,50,14 |
244 | 244 | ICON ffftp,-1,7,4,20,20 |
245 | - CTEXT "FFFTP Ver 1.99a-20171028",-1,110,11,90,8 | |
245 | + CTEXT "FFFTP Ver 1.99a-20171029",-1,110,11,90,8 | |
246 | 246 | CTEXT "FFFTP is freeware",-1,7,281,301,8 |
247 | 247 | CTEXT "Copyright(C) 1997-2010 Sota && cooperators\nCopyright (C) 2011-2017 FFFTP Project (Hiromichi Matsushima, Suguru Kawamoto, IWAMOTO Kouichi, vitamin0x, unarist, Asami, fortran90, tomo1192, Yuji Tanaka, Moriguchi Hirokazu, Fu-sen)",-1,7,25,301,44 |
248 | 248 | CTEXT "",ABOUT_JRE,7,93,301,8 |
@@ -2253,8 +2253,8 @@ nodrop_csr CURSOR "nodrop_c.cur" | ||
2253 | 2253 | // |
2254 | 2254 | |
2255 | 2255 | VS_VERSION_INFO VERSIONINFO |
2256 | - FILEVERSION 1,99,1,17 | |
2257 | - PRODUCTVERSION 1,99,1,17 | |
2256 | + FILEVERSION 1,99,1,18 | |
2257 | + PRODUCTVERSION 1,99,1,18 | |
2258 | 2258 | FILEFLAGSMASK 0x3fL |
2259 | 2259 | #ifdef _DEBUG |
2260 | 2260 | FILEFLAGS 0x1L |
@@ -2272,12 +2272,12 @@ BEGIN | ||
2272 | 2272 | VALUE "Comments", "This software is Free Software" |
2273 | 2273 | VALUE "CompanyName", "Sota, FFFTP Project" |
2274 | 2274 | VALUE "FileDescription", "FFFTP" |
2275 | - VALUE "FileVersion", "1, 99, 1, 17" | |
2275 | + VALUE "FileVersion", "1, 99, 1, 18" | |
2276 | 2276 | VALUE "InternalName", "FFFTP" |
2277 | 2277 | VALUE "LegalCopyright", "Copyright (C) 1997-2010 Sota & cooperators\nCopyright (C) 2011-2017 FFFTP Project (Hiromichi Matsushima, Suguru Kawamoto, IWAMOTO Kouichi, vitamin0x, unarist, Asami, fortran90, tomo1192, Yuji Tanaka, Moriguchi Hirokazu, Fu-sen)." |
2278 | 2278 | VALUE "OriginalFilename", "FFFTP.exe" |
2279 | 2279 | VALUE "ProductName", "FFFTP" |
2280 | - VALUE "ProductVersion", "1, 99, 1, 17" | |
2280 | + VALUE "ProductVersion", "1, 99, 1, 18" | |
2281 | 2281 | END |
2282 | 2282 | END |
2283 | 2283 | BLOCK "VarFileInfo" |
@@ -72,16 +72,16 @@ | ||
72 | 72 | //#define PROGRAM_VERSION_NUM 1972 /* バージョン */ |
73 | 73 | // 64ビット対応 |
74 | 74 | #ifdef _WIN64 |
75 | -#define VER_STR "1.99a-20171028 64bit" | |
75 | +#define VER_STR "1.99a-20171029 64bit" | |
76 | 76 | #else |
77 | -#define VER_STR "1.99a-20171028" | |
77 | +#define VER_STR "1.99a-20171029" | |
78 | 78 | #endif |
79 | 79 | #define VER_NUM 1990 /* 設定バージョン */ |
80 | 80 | #define PROGRAM_VERSION_NUM 1990 /* バージョン */ |
81 | 81 | // ソフトウェア自動更新 |
82 | 82 | // リリースバージョンはリリース予定年(10進数4桁)+月(2桁)+日(2桁)+通し番号(0スタート2桁)とする |
83 | 83 | // 2014年7月31日中の30個目のリリースは2014073129 |
84 | -#define RELEASE_VERSION_NUM 2017102800 /* リリースバージョン */ | |
84 | +#define RELEASE_VERSION_NUM 2017102900 /* リリースバージョン */ | |
85 | 85 | |
86 | 86 | |
87 | 87 | // SourceForge.JPによるフォーク |
@@ -792,8 +792,7 @@ static ULONG WINAPI TransferThread(void *Dummy) | ||
792 | 792 | } |
793 | 793 | if(AskReuseCmdSkt() == YES && ThreadCount == 0) |
794 | 794 | { |
795 | - if(TransPacketBase && ThreadCount < AskMaxThreadCount()) | |
796 | - TrnSkt = AskTrnCtrlSkt(); | |
795 | + TrnSkt = AskTrnCtrlSkt(); | |
797 | 796 | // セッションあたりの転送量制限対策 |
798 | 797 | if(TrnSkt != INVALID_SOCKET && AskErrorReconnect() == YES && LastError == YES) |
799 | 798 | { |
@@ -859,7 +858,7 @@ static ULONG WINAPI TransferThread(void *Dummy) | ||
859 | 858 | { |
860 | 859 | // 同時ログイン数制限対策 |
861 | 860 | // 60秒間使用されなければログアウト |
862 | - if(timeGetTime() - LastUsed > 60000 || AskConnecting() == NO) | |
861 | + if(timeGetTime() - LastUsed > 60000 || AskConnecting() == NO || ThreadCount >= AskMaxThreadCount()) | |
863 | 862 | { |
864 | 863 | ReleaseMutex(hListAccMutex); |
865 | 864 | DoQUIT(TrnSkt, &Canceled[ThreadCount]); |